As the world eagerly awaits the release of Kanye West's seventh LP later this year, Mr. West treats us to the first slice of new music since last year's 'Yeezus' in adidas' new 2014 FIFA World Cup commercial.

The song, titled 'God Level,' features rumbling percussion to match the butterfly-in-the-stomach feeling that the players will no doubt be experiencing ahead of the tournament in Brazil this summer. While the track is mostly instrumental, Yeezzy spits a few lines.

"You see sharks in the water / You don't see a murder like this this often / Provide a new coffin / You don't see a murder like this this often," he raps, before announcing, "God level" towards the end.

Meanwhile, the 1-minute long spot, dubbed 'The Dream: all or nothing,' includes appearances from some of soccer's biggest stars, including Leo Messi, Xavi, Luis Suárez, Robin van Persie, Mesut Özil, Dani Alves, Bastian Schweinsteiger, David Villa and Jordi Alba, who do what they do best on the field.

This marks West's first official collaboration with adidas since announcing a deal with the footwear and apparel giant back in November. He's currently prepping his first clothing collection, including a new Yeezy shoe, which is set to debut early next year.
